The Pi coin price has seen a troubling trajectory recently, dropping over 4% and falling below the $0.70 mark. This decline has not gone unnoticed, sparking discontent within the Pi Network community. Users have expressed frustration over the project’s communication style and perceived lack of activity within the ecosystem. Despite the recent announcement of PiFest, skepticism persists among traders, leading analysts to predict further price declines with a crucial support level identified around $0.60. However, some optimistic investors still cling to hopes of a long-term recovery.
In a stark turn of events, the Pi Coin price has plummeted by 20% in just one week, accompanied by a staggering 52% crash in trading volumes, which now sit at $148 million. This increasing selling pressure indicates a growing lack of confidence among traders regarding the future of the Pi Network. Although PiFest attracted record participation—with over 125,000 sellers and 1.8 million users—the prevailing sentiment remains one of dissatisfaction among community members, emphasizing the need for more robust engagement and excitement within the ecosystem.
Mining Rate Decline and Trading Activity Slowdown
One significant factor contributing to this downturn is the recent reduction of the base mining rate by the Pi Network, which has decreased by 1.18%, now yielding 0.0029030 Ï€ per hour. This decline in mining rewards may lead to waning interest from existing miners as the financial incentives diminish. Fewer rewards could translate into less market participation, ultimately reducing the number of active miners and further impacting the network’s overall activity.
Despite discussions about securing listings on major exchanges like Binance and Coinbase, concrete progress has been stagnant. Although the BTCC exchange recently introduced spot trading for Pi, the anticipated price recovery did not follow suit. Without broader adoption and more exchanges facilitating trading, liquidity remains a significant hurdle for potential investors.
Bearish Market Indicators: Pi Coin Struggles with Volatility and Selling Pressure
On April 2, Pi coin experienced notable volatility, starting the day at $0.6915 and peaking at $0.6918, reflecting only a modest 0.04% gain. However, the overarching trend has been downward, highlighted by a recent 3.83% decline that intensifies bearish market sentiments. The trading volume during this time was sluggish, registering at only 10.23K, which demonstrates weak buying interest and heightens worries about further declines.

Technical indicators tell a concerning story as well. The Relative Strength Index (RSI) has hovered around 39.42, inching closer to oversold territory, while the RSI’s moving average stands at 39.78—both of which suggest heightened volatility and continued selling pressure. This technical setup indicates that Pi may require significant momentum to reverse its current trend.

Analysts are observing a potential falling wedge pattern forming, with the lower boundary testing around $0.687. A breakout above the $0.71–$0.72 range could signal a short-term bullish reversal. Resistance levels, if established, are expected between $0.75 and $0.78. However, should Pi fail to uphold the support at $0.687, a drop to $0.60 seems likely.
